Winemaking Notes
Grapes were handpicked, crushed then yeasted a day later. Hand plunged twice a day until sugar dryness. Pressed and sent into barrels for malolactic fermentation. Wine stays on lees all winter before being racked and sent into French oak barrels until bottling. No animal products used in processing.
Cellared for 3 years before release.
Tasting Notes
Our 2022 vintage is nicely concentrated, with attractive Burgundian touches of wood and spice. The overall mouth feel is elegant and generous, with soft balancing tannins and hints of black cherry and blueberry. Persistent finish. Drinking well now, it will further improve with 3 to 7 years cellaring. A great food wine, especially with salmon, duck and Italian food.
